We intentionally invest within two miles of our home in the neighborhoods of West Vancouver, but I would consider going outside that area if I found a screaming deal.I choose to keep my investments within Clark County Washington State because I know the municipal, county and state laws here regarding rental property and landlord-tenant law, I know the courts and attorneys here, I have a good working relationship with the city police and county sheriff here, I am active in the local rental association, I have established my tried and true vendors here, I know these neighborhoods, I know this market very well and my business licenses are in place for operating in this location.I love the fact that most of our rental units are located between my home and my place of work, so I can easily drive by and keep an eye on them.
